Saturday is the first official Barn Owl Review reading and release party. Here are the details:

Please join editors, contributors, and fans of Barn Owl Review Saturday, March 1st, for our official Cleveland release party and reading. BOR Editors-in-Chief Mary Biddinger and Jay Robinson will read with Emily Anderson (of Warbler fame), Michelle Krivanek, and Kate Sopko. Bela Dubby's is a fabulous venue, with art, coffee, and beers galore.

Saturday, March 1st
Bela Dubby's
13321 Madison Ave.
Lakewood, OH 44107


Reading starts at 9:30 pm, but swing by earlier for beer and camaraderie.
